Fentanyl patches, good and bad. Your Doc should start you on a low dose. 12.5mg or 25mg when you put a patch on it may take several hours before you reach good pain relief, the patch is good for 3 days and on the last day most people can feel the medication fading. Most people need a breakthrough medication to take as needed. It can make you sedated at first, but once your body adjust to the dose you should be okay. Also depending if your skinny or have some fat tissue the absorption may vary. It's also cost a lot! I know that you have been on different pain medications and have problems with pain. I hope this works for you, make sure you work with your doctor and tell them any problems that you are having. Don't tell a lot of people about the kind of pain medication that you are using Fentanly patches have a high street value, people that abusive medication will often suck on the patches to get a high, but if you use it correctly it can work well in general. Never share information on what medications that you are using to people that live close to you, unless you absolutely trust them!
